Every Module Is A Task You'll Repeat On The Job
Nothing here is taught as a vocabulary list. Each topic is a task from a live USA & Canada dispatch shift, drilled through hands-on practice and guided repetition until you can do it without thinking about it.
Load Booking
Filter lanes, compare rate per mile, and lock a load on DAT and similar load boards before a faster dispatcher takes it.
Broker Negotiation
Practise the counter-offer — what to say when a broker lowballs you and when walking away is the smarter call.
Rate Confirmation
Check every line against what was agreed on the phone, so detention, layover, and accessorial terms never surprise you later.
Dispatch Software Training
Build real speed inside TMS dashboards, tracking tools, and ELD portals instead of watching someone else click through them.
Driver Communication
Handle check calls, reroutes, and bad news with drivers in a tone that keeps them on your side all week.
USA & Canada Trucking Operations
See how a shipper, broker, carrier, and driver connect on one load, and exactly where your seat sits in that chain.
Customs Clearance
Prepare a cross-border run properly — PARS and PAPS basics, broker handoff, and the documents a driver cannot reach the line without.
Documentation & Paperwork
Move through carrier packets, BOLs, trip sheets, and invoicing quickly enough that paperwork never holds up a payment.
Finding Clients
Know where owner-operators actually hang out online and what to say in the first two minutes to earn a trial week.

🚚 Truck Dispatcher
Own a board of trucks end to end — source the loads, settle the rate, dispatch the driver, and keep every unit loaded through the week.
📦 Freight Broker Assistant
Work beside a broker on carrier vetting, insurance checks, load tracking, and the customer updates that keep accounts loyal.
📍 Logistics Coordinator
Plan routes, slot appointment times, and keep a shipper's outbound schedule from falling behind.
💻 Work From Home Dispatcher
US carriers routinely hire India-based dispatchers to cover their hours — a laptop, a stable connection, and a headset is the whole setup.
🏢 Independent Dispatch Agency
After a year or two of real reps, take on your own owner-operators on a percentage and work for yourself from Jalalabad.
The Money Side: What Dispatchers From Jalalabad Take Home 💰
Pay in dispatch usually arrives as a base salary with commission stacked on top once you prove you can hold margin. Students finishing our truck dispatch training in Jalalabad walk into interviews already fluent in the boards and the software, which is the difference between getting screened out and getting put on a desk in the first month.
A first job usually comes from a dispatch agency or a small carrier's India team. Entry-level pay in this field generally sits between ₹15,000 and ₹40,000 per month, moving up fast once you're trusted with rate calls.
Plenty of American carriers staff their after-hours board from India — same work, paid against US rates, done entirely from home.
Experienced dispatchers often drop the salary entirely and charge a percentage per truck, scaling income by adding units rather than waiting on a raise.
